What is the total number of moles of ' C ' atoms and ' H ' atoms respectively present in following n mole molecule ?

Options

  1. A4 n and 2 n
  2. B4 n and 4 n
  3. C6 n and 14 n
  4. D6 n and 6 n

Correct answer

C. 6 n and 14 n

Step-by-step solution

Interpreting the skeletal structure reveals a symmetrical C 6 H 14 molecule (2,3-dimethylbutane). Each terminal carbon bonds to three hydrogens, middle carbons bond to one hydrogen each, and methyl substituents each carry three hydrogens, totaling 14 hydrogen atoms. For n moles of C 6 H 14 , carbon atoms total 6n moles and hydrogen atoms total 14n moles, corresponding to option C .
